What did you have breakfast today? I had nasi lemak (rice cooked in coconut milk) of course.

Nasi Lemak at RM1.80.
Look at the pack above, so big and heavy. I bought it from a stall in front of a Mobil petrol station in Puchong. It costed RM1.80, althought it’s big, but not much ingredients inside; no chicken drumstick and no sotong (squid)

Nasi Lemak.
Look how nicely they pack the nasi lemak. If you put two of those side by side, it’s like a twin peak
The one I tried is the nasi lemak biasa (the ordinary type), without any chicken. The one with chicken costs RM3.50 I think. Can’t really remember the price.
Nasi Lemak - one of Malaysian’s favorite dish, can be eaten at any time - breakfast, second breakfast, elevenses, lunch, tea, dinner, supper, post-boozeup - and the creamy, hot & spicy flavors makes it simply satisfying!

1.80 for nasi lemak biasa? ya, expensive. usually nasi lemak don’t have chicken (or sotong). the basic choices in nasi lemak biasa are ikan bilis or ikan or telur or udang. so you choose which you want. of course there are some stalls selling all those 4 together in a packet.
